Bang Bang Chicken Skewers: Bold, Spicy, and Irresistible!
A delicious and spicy Chinese street food classic, these Bang Bang Chicken Skewers are marinated in soy sauce, garlic, ginger, and chili, then grilled to perfection. Originating from the Sichuan province, they’re easy to make and bursting with flavor, perfect for a snack or main course.
- 1.5–2 lbs chicken breast or thighscut into 1-inch pieces
- 1/4 cup soy sauce
- 2 cloves garlicminced
- 1-inch piece gingergrated
- 1–2 chili pepperssliced
- 1/4 cup peanut or vegetable oil
- 1 tablespoon honey
- 1 teaspoon cumin
- 1/2 teaspoon coriander
- 1/2 teaspoon paprika
**For the Bang Bang Sauce:**
- 1/4 cup mayonnaise
- 2 tablespoons Thai sweet chili sauce
- 1 teaspoon srirachaadjust to taste
- 1 tablespoon honey
Instructions
**Prepare the Marinade:**
In a mixing bowl, combine soy sauce, garlic, ginger, chili peppers, oil, honey, cumin, coriander, and paprika. Mix well.
**Marinate the Chicken:**
Add chicken pieces to the marinade, ensuring all pieces are coated. Cover and refrigerate for at least 30 minutes (or overnight for best results).
**Prepare the Skewers:**
Thread the marinated chicken onto skewers, leaving small gaps for even cooking.
**Grill the Skewers:**
Preheat your grill or grill pan to medium-high heat. Cook skewers for 6–8 minutes per side or until the chicken reaches an internal temperature of 165°F.
**Make the Sauce:**
In a small bowl, mix mayonnaise, Thai sweet chili sauce, sriracha, and honey until smooth.
**Serve and Enjoy:**
Drizzle the Bang Bang sauce over the skewers or serve it on the side for dipping. Pair with rice, noodles, or a fresh salad.
